İçindekiler:
- Gereçler
- 1. Adım: Öykü
- Adım 2: Buzzer Bloğunun Kurulumu
- Adım 3: Inject Block'u Ayarlayın
- Adım 4: Sonunda Blokları Yerleştirme
Video: Magicbit [Magicblocks] üzerinde Buzzer'ı kullanın: 4 Adım
2024 Yazar: John Day | [email protected]. Son düzenleme: 2024-01-30 13:16
Bu eğitim size Magicblocks kullanarak Magicbit'te zili kullanmayı öğretecektir. ESP32 tabanlı bu projede geliştirme kartı olarak magicbit kullanıyoruz. Bu nedenle bu projede herhangi bir ESP32 geliştirme kartı kullanılabilir.
Gereçler
Magicbit - Profesyonel
1. Adım: Öykü
Merhaba ve Hoş Geldiniz, Bu eğitim size Magicblocks kullanarak Magicbit'te zili kullanmayı öğretecektir.
Bu hedefe ulaşmanın 1 ana yöntemi vardır;
Enjekte Bloğu kullanarak.
Öncelikle Magicblocks hesabınıza giriş yapın, Magicblocks, magicbit'inizi programlamak için kolay bir görsel programlama yazılımıdır. Magicblocks.io kullanarak herkes mikro denetleyicisini programlayabilir ve programlama bilgisine gerek yoktur. Ücretsiz üye olabilirsiniz.
Oyun Alanını Başlatın ve Açın.
Ardından, Magicbit'inizin internete bağlı ve takılı olduğundan ve ayrıca Aygıt Yöneticisi aracılığıyla hesabınıza bağlı olduğundan emin olun.
Hepsi tamam? sonra Yöntem 1'e ilerleyin
Gerekli Öğelerin Listesi
Magicbit: Magicbit, öğrenme, prototip oluşturma, kodlama, elektronik, robotik, IoT ve çözüm tasarımı için ESP32 tabanlı entegre bir geliştirme platformudur.
Adım 2: Buzzer Bloğunun Kurulumu
1. Buzzer bloğunu Magicbit düğümleri bölümünden akışa sürükleyip bırakın.
2. Buzzer bloğuna çift tıklayın ve Magicblocks hesabınızdaki Aygıt Yöneticisi Sekmesinden benzersiz Aygıt kimliğinizi yazın veya yapıştırın. [Bu, Magicbit'inizdeki zili Magicblocks hesabınızla bağlayacaktır]
3. Frekans, sesli uyarının frekansını belirler.
4. Süre, buzzer çıkışının süresini belirler.
Adım 3: Inject Block'u Ayarlayın
(Bu Düğüm, sesli uyarıyı bir aralık arasında tekrar tekrar etkinleştirmek için kullanılır)
1. Ekranın solundaki giriş düğümleri bölümünden Inject Block'u akışa sürükleyip bırakın.
2. Yük türünün zaman damgası olduğundan ve tekrarın aralık olarak ayarlandığından emin olun.
3. Ardından bir aralık ayarlayın, bu, buzzer çıkışları arasındaki gecikmeyi belirleyecektir.
[İsteğe Bağlı] Zaten Ayarlanmış Düğümleri İçe Aktarın
Düğümleri kurmakta sorun yaşıyorsanız, zaten kurulmuş olan düğümleri almak için Magicblocks'taki içe aktarma özelliğini kullanabilirsiniz.
- Önce bu kodu panonuza kopyalayın.
- Ekranın sağ üst köşesindeki seçenekler menüsüne tıklayın.
- Ardından, imlecinizi İçe Aktar alt menüsünün üzerine getirin.
- Ardından Pano'ya tıklayın ve panonuzdaki kodu metin alanına yapıştırın.
- Mevcut akışı veya yeni akışı seçin ve İçe Aktar'a tıklayın.
ÖNEMLİ
Cihaz kimliğinizi Buzzer düğüm özelliklerine yazdığınızdan emin olun.
Adım 4: Sonunda Blokları Yerleştirme
- Tüm blokları bağlayın.
- Ekranın sağ üst köşesindeki Dağıt düğmesine tıklayın.
- Buzzer verilen frekans, süre ve gecikmeye göre devreye girecektir.
-
Buzzer'dan frekansları değiştirebilir ve farklı bir frekans çıkışı alabilirsiniz.
Sorun giderme
- Magicbit'inizin internete bağlı olup olmadığını kontrol edin.
- Buzzer düğümü özelliklerinde Cihaz Kimliğinin doğru olup olmadığını kontrol edin.
Önerilen:
Magicbit'inizde [Magicblocks] Basmalı Düğmeleri Kullanın: 5 Adım
Magicbit'inizde [Magicblocks] Basmalı Düğmeleri Kullanın: Bu eğitim size Magicblock'ları kullanarak Magicbit'inizdeki Basmalı Düğmeleri kullanmayı öğretecektir. ESP32 tabanlı bu projede geliştirme kartı olarak magicbit kullanıyoruz. Bu nedenle bu projede herhangi bir ESP32 geliştirme kartı kullanılabilir
Magicbit [Magicblocks] ile Yakınlık Sensörü Yapın: 6 Adım
Magicbit [Magicblocks] ile Yakınlık Sensörü Yapın: Bu eğitim size Magicblocks kullanarak Magicbit ile bir Yakınlık Sensörü kullanmayı öğretecektir. ESP32 tabanlı bu projede geliştirme kartı olarak magicbit kullanıyoruz. Bu nedenle bu projede herhangi bir ESP32 geliştirme kartı kullanılabilir
Magicbit [Magicblocks] ile Toprak Nemi Sensörünü Kullanın: 5 Adım
Magicbit [Magicblocks] ile Toprak Nemi Sensörünü Kullanın: Bu eğitim size Magicblocks kullanarak Magicbit'inizle Toprak Nemi Sensörünü kullanmayı öğretecektir. ESP32 tabanlı bu projede geliştirme kartı olarak magicbit kullanıyoruz. Bu nedenle bu projede herhangi bir ESP32 geliştirme kartı kullanılabilir
Magicbit [Magicblocks] ile Pano Widget'larını Kullanın: 5 Adım
Magicbit [Magicblocks] ile Pano Widget'larını Kullanın: Bu eğitim size Magicbit'inizle Magicblocks Pano Widget'larını kullanmayı öğretecektir. ESP32 tabanlı bu projede geliştirme kartı olarak magicbit kullanıyoruz. Bu nedenle bu projede herhangi bir ESP32 geliştirme kartı kullanılabilir
Magicbit [Magicblocks] ile Ultrasonik Sensör Kullanın: 5 Adım
Magicbit [Magicblocks] ile Ultrasonik Sensör Kullanın: Bu eğitim size Magicblocks kullanarak Magicbit'inizle Ultrasonik Sensörü kullanmayı öğretecektir. ESP32 tabanlı bu projede geliştirme kartı olarak magicbit kullanıyoruz. Bu nedenle bu projede herhangi bir ESP32 geliştirme kartı kullanılabilir